CV53 FLF is a 2003 Vauxhall Astra in Blue with a 1,598c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 83.3%.
Across all 2003 Vauxhall Astra models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.2% with a typical mileage of 74,512 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Astra f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 1,048,496 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CV53 FLF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Astra typ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 23 years old, this Vauxhall Astra is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
